Describe the bug
Dll-extraction fails for Microsoft Visual C++ Redistributable 143 Merge Module with following error:
Failed to create view with query: SELECT * FROM `Media`
Technical Detail:
   at Microsoft.Tools.WindowsInstallerXml.Msi.View..ctor(Database db, String query)
   at Microsoft.Tools.WindowsInstallerXml.Msi.Database.OpenExecuteView(String query)
   at LessMsi.Msi.Wixtracts.CabsFromMsiToDisk(Path msi, Database msidb, String outputDir)
   at LessMsi.Msi.Wixtracts.ExtractFiles(Path msi, String outputDir, MsiFile[] filesToExtract, AsyncCallback progressCallback, ExtractionMode extractionMode)
   at LessMsi.Gui.MainForm.btnExtract_Click(Object sender, EventArgs e)
To Reproduce
Steps to reproduce the behavior:
- Install 
Visual Studio Installer, then the componentC++ 2022 Redistributable-MSMs. - Open the file 
C:\Program Files\Microsoft Visual Studio\2022\Community\VC\Redist\MSVC\v143\MergeModules\Microsoft_VC143_CRT_x64.msmin LessMSI. - Click on 'Extract'.
 - See error, no dlls are extracted.
 
Expected behavior
The extraction should succeed without an error popout and the dlls should be visible in the target directory.
